Output 5a97175144296a24d342e1b95acc6ae94a36cde0a22d1f1077c7427ef7ca456c:0

value
633076802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c8bad6f637f91f2257ad7ce0f4298401b84e0ef OP_EQUAL
address
35kYywowa1V8AHufo9iJxB8ZKcnk4EHTm7
transaction
5a97175144296a24d342e1b95acc6ae94a36cde0a22d1f1077c7427ef7ca456c
confirmations
494116
spent
true